The marketing mix modeling row is the single biggest product difference. Rockerbox ships MMM as a first-class feature alongside MTA and incrementality testing. That matters for brands spending across TV, CTV, podcast, influencer, affiliate, and paid social, where pure click-based attribution can&#8217;t see the upper funnel. Hyros doesn&#8217;t compete in MMM and doesn&#8217;t pretend to. Hyros is a deterministic tracking product, not a media mix estimator.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The incrementality row is a related gap. Rockerbox runs native incrementality testing, including geo tests and holdout groups, to measure causal lift on individual channels. That is an analyst workflow with real setup time and is worth the effort for brands running $500K or more per month across many channels. Hyros provides limited incrementality tooling and leans instead on precision deterministic tracking to separate converting clicks from organic ones.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">On the Hyros Shopify integration page, they report specific platform underreporting gaps: Facebook underreports conversions by approximately 30%, Google by 29%, and TikTok by 33%. MTA, MMM, and incrementality testing are three different disciplines, and the three outputs don&#8217;t always agree. Brands with analysts in the building will extract real value from reconciling those signals. Brands without them will spend budget on a platform they can&#8217;t fully operate.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">For related comparisons, see the <a href=\"https:\/\/hyros.com\/updates\/hyros-vs-triple-whale\" rel=\"noopener\">Hyros vs Triple Whale breakdown<\/a>, the <a href=\"https:\/\/hyros.com\/updates\/hyros-vs-northbeam\" rel=\"noopener\">Hyros vs Northbeam comparison<\/a>, the <a href=\"https:\/\/hyros.com\/updates\/hyros-vs-wicked-reports\" rel=\"noopener\">Hyros vs Wicked Reports comparison<\/a>, and the <a href=\"https:\/\/hyros.com\/updates\/hyros-vs-cometly\" rel=\"noopener\">Hyros vs Cometly comparison<\/a>. Hyros tracks deterministic click-based paid media extremely well, including Meta, Google, TikTok, YouTube, and other clickable channels. Upper-funnel channels like linear TV, CTV, podcast, and OOH don&#8217;t generate clean clicks, which is where marketing mix modeling is the correct method. Hyros doesn&#8217;t ship native MMM. Brands with meaningful upper-funnel spend alongside paid social and search will often run Hyros for the deterministic click layer and layer an MMM tool on top, or choose Rockerbox for the bundled approach.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">How long does Rockerbox take to deploy compared with Hyros?<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Hyros is typically live within days.
